The Amazon Web Services Professional Services (ProServe) team is seeking a Delivery Consultant specializing in Data to join our AWS Industries practice. You will be at the center of the most consequential shift in enterprise technology: making organizations truly AI-ready. Every agentic AI system, every foundation model grounded in enterprise knowledge, and every GenAI application that moves from prototype to production depends on the data layer beneath it - and that's what you build.
You will design and implement modern data platforms (lake, lakehouse, mesh), architect data pipelines that transform raw, fragmented data estates into governed, AI-ready assets; and design and implement enterprise RAG architectures, vector stores, semantic ontologies, and knowledge graph architectures that allow foundation models and AI agents to reason accurately, access data securely, and execute autonomously. You will work hands-on inside customer environments with complex data lineage, legacy systems, and build production-grade data solutions that serve multiple downstream consumers, from ML model training to agentic orchestration layers.
The AWS Professional Services organization is a global team of experts that help customers realize their desired business outcomes when using AWS services. We work together with customer teams and the AWS Partner Network (APN) to execute enterprise cloud computing and AI transformation initiatives.
This role requires approximately 50% co-location on site with customer, AWS and partner teams within the U.S.
